    I thought I would post a note here for those new to this forum regarding what they can expect from its members. The members on this forum are by large SVO enthusiasts and owners who are interested in preserving the SVO, it's history and sharing information and tips. If you are coming here looking to part out a perfectly good car or looking for SVO parts to install on your Non-SVO then you can expect that there may be some flak generated by your postings....This is simply because SVO owners are passionate about their cars. We as SVO owners face a problem of limited parts availability and being such a low production car have a problem getting parts reproduced for such a small market. We have been faced with people scavenging things like PE computers, wings, side spats, taillights, seats, etc for other Mustangs and Turbo Fords or Turbo projects for years so it is frustrating for an SVO owner when he/she cannot find a replacement part because they have all been taken for other cars/projects. We fully appreciate other Enthusiasts and non-SVO owners projects and will help whenever possible but please take any criticism and suggestions as constructive and not as a flame. Using a Turbo Coupe computer, pinstriping standard 83-86 Taillights for non-SVOs and suggestions against installing a V8 are not designed to flame anyone, rather they are intended to help preserve the SVO and help keep parts available for those who really need them.

    We can all understand that there comes a time when some SVOs are destined to be parts cars and that is fine....what we have a problem with is someone buying a car that runs and drives without damage or one that is easily put back on the road and parts it out trying to make a quick buck...those individuals are not doing this hobby any favors and are only reducing the number of restorable cars therefore reducing our chances even more for reproduction parts by making the market even smaller.
